When did Yamaha stop making the Venture Royale?
Yamaha stopped production of the Venture Royale in 1989 but brought it back as the Yamaha Venture in 1999. The Engine in the V-Max makes 145 HP at the crank, in the Venture it maked 98 HP and 89 FPT.
How much oil is in a Yamaha Venture?
Quick Service Guide 83~93 Venture Engine Oil Change: Oil Change Procedure Engine Oil Capacity: With Filter Change Without Filter Change 3.5L (3.7 US qt)3.2L (3.4 US qt) Oil Drain Plug ……

When was the last year the Chevy Venture was made?
2003 model year-More equipment packages were introduced for 2003. The Venture is now available with XM Satellite Radio. 2004 model year-The LT trim is discontinued. 2005 model year-This is the last year for the Venture.
What kind of engine does a Chevy Venture have?
The Venture and its siblings were powered by GM’s 3.4 L LA1 V6, rated at 180 hp (134 kW). After 1999, the engine was slightly redesigned to produce an extra 5 hp (4 kW), for a total of 185 hp (138 kW), and the alarm system for seatbelts, door ajar, low fuel, etc. have been changed. All Ventures used a four-speed automatic transmission.

What was the rating of the 1997 Chevy Venture?
The U.S. National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) gave the 1997 Chevrolet Venture a rating of four stars out of five in a head-on collision, and five stars in the side-impact collision. Tests on subsequent model years yielded results of four stars in most categories, and three or five stars in others.
